The immense knowledge of this field enables us to bring forth Red Mud Dewatering Anionic Polyacrylamide. The provided chemical is used to flocculate solids in a liquid. The offered chemical have been used in dewatering "red mud" from bauxites in the Bayer process for extraction of alumina. This is used for industrial and potable water treatment, paper mills and mining industry. It has very good performance in red mud dewatering for alumina production. Technical Specifications:

  • Appearance: White granule
  • Molecular weight: 5 - 22 million minimum
  • Granule: 20 - 100 mesh
  • Solid content: 88% minimum
  • Hydrolyzing degree: 10 - 20%, 20 - 30% or 30 - 40%
  • Dissolving time: 2 hours maximum (10º C)
  • Insoluble: 0.5% maximum
  • Monomer free: 0.05% maximum

FAQs of Red Mud Dewatering Anionic Polyacrylamide:


Q: How should the Red Mud Dewatering Anionic Polyacrylamide be prepared for use?

A: This polymer must be diluted in water before application. It is best to gradually add the granules to water under constant stirring, allowing it to dissolve completely within 60 minutes at around 25C for optimal performance.

Q: What is the recommended application for this polyacrylamide?

A: It is ideal for dewatering red mud, treating wastewater, and separating slurries in mining industry operations, offering superior water clarity and sedimentation.

Q: When should this product be applied during wastewater or slurry treatment?

A: Apply the diluted solution during or after the initial agitation stage, when the solid-liquid separation process is required to achieve fast settling and clear supernatant.

Q: Where should Red Mud Dewatering Polyacrylamide be stored?

A: Store the product in a cool, dry place, away from direct sunlight and moisture. This preserves its granular form and maximizes its 24-month shelf life.

Q: What is the process for using this anionic polyacrylamide in industrial applications?

A: After dissolving the appropriate amount in water, introduce the solution into the wastewater or slurry. Agitate gently to ensure even distribution, allowing solids to aggregate and promote rapid settling.

Q: What are the benefits of using this dewatering polymer in mining or industrial wastewater treatment?

A: It enhances solid-liquid separation, reduces water content in sludge, minimizes disposal costs, and improves process efficiency, all while being non-toxic under recommended usage.
